Abstract
In a screen configuration in which pixels are in a delta arrangement, video signal lines are formed on every other pixel, and two scanning lines in one set are disposed, transmittance of the screen is improved. Pixels corresponding to a red pixel (R), a green pixel (G), and a blue pixel (B) are disposed in a delta arrangement in a TFT substrate. A red color filter, a green color filter, a blue color filter are formed, in a counter substrate, corresponding to the red pixel (R), the green pixel (G), and the blue pixel (B) of the TFT substrate. A black matrix is formed to a portion where the color filter is not present. Two blue color filters are formed continuously adjacent each other in the first direction, and a black matrix is not formed between the blue color filters adjacent each other.
